What Is the Cost of Living Near Miami?

Understanding the cost of living near Miami is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Hammurabi.
Miami's Cost of Living Index is approximately 117.5 (17.5% more expensive than US average; 14.0% more than FL average). Major international city, very high housing costs, vibrant culture, significant traffic. Metrorail/Metromover/B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Hammurabi,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,800 - $2,800+ A significant portion of Hammurabi sal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$270 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$112.50 (Miami-Dade EASY Ticket monthly)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$440 - $660 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$850+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,262 - $5,332+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
